samwell commited on
Commit
d32145b
·
1 Parent(s): f65bee4

Use backwards-compatible langchain.chains import for RetrievalQA

Browse files
Files changed (2) hide show
  1. medrax/rag/rag.py +1 -1
  2. medrax/tools/rag.py +1 -1
medrax/rag/rag.py CHANGED
@@ -9,7 +9,7 @@ from langchain_community.document_loaders import TextLoader, PyPDFLoader, Docx2t
9
  from langchain_text_splitters import RecursiveCharacterTextSplitter
10
  from langchain_pinecone import PineconeVectorStore
11
  from pinecone import Pinecone
12
- from langchain_community.chains import RetrievalQA
13
  from langchain_community.chat_message_histories import ChatMessageHistory
14
  from langchain_core.runnables.history import RunnableWithMessageHistory
15
  from langchain_core.retrievers import BaseRetriever
 
9
  from langchain_text_splitters import RecursiveCharacterTextSplitter
10
  from langchain_pinecone import PineconeVectorStore
11
  from pinecone import Pinecone
12
+ from langchain.chains import RetrievalQA
13
  from langchain_community.chat_message_histories import ChatMessageHistory
14
  from langchain_core.runnables.history import RunnableWithMessageHistory
15
  from langchain_core.retrievers import BaseRetriever
medrax/tools/rag.py CHANGED
@@ -1,6 +1,6 @@
1
  from langchain_core.tools import BaseTool
2
  from medrax.rag.rag import RAGConfig, CohereRAG
3
- from langchain_community.chains import RetrievalQA
4
  from typing import Dict, Tuple, Any
5
 
6
 
 
1
  from langchain_core.tools import BaseTool
2
  from medrax.rag.rag import RAGConfig, CohereRAG
3
+ from langchain.chains import RetrievalQA
4
  from typing import Dict, Tuple, Any
5
 
6